Étape 3: Vérifier l’appel de l’API sur SafeCast
Nous allons maintenant tester l’accès au serveur par le biais de SafeCast avec votre clé API.
Pour l’utilisateur de Windows, la barre de recherche de programme, vous pouvez trouver Powershell ISE puis copiez le code suivant dans l’interface de l’exécution.
Claire
$safeCastApi = « https://api.safecast.org » $apiKey = « QEETXXXXXXX » $captureTime = Get-Date-format "AAAA-MM-j h:mm:s" $captureTime $body = $header = "Content-Type" = "application/json" ; }; Invoquer-RestMethod-méthode Post - Uri (« $safeCastAPI/measurements.json?api_key= » + $apiKey)-corps (ConvertTo-Json $body) - en-tête $header
Avant d’exécuter ce script, vous devez adapter sur la 3ème ligne, la répartition de la variable $apiKey avec votre clé API.
Enregistrez et exécutez ce code avec F5.
Pour les utilisateur de Linux, de la même manière, remplacer la valeur suite api_key la bonne combinaison et puis exécutez le script suivant dans une console :
curl -k -H "Content-Type : application/json" X - POST -d "{« location_name »: « XXXXXXX », « longitude »:6.333336000000029,:49.33333"latitude","valeur":1.2"unité":"microsievert"}'https://api.safecast.org/measurements.json?api_key=QEETXXXXXXXXXX